Granite: The Product and the People. The 19th century granite industry provided jobs for men on the islands as well as on the mainland. The Wiscasset, now historic, jail was completed in 1811 with granite walls from the Edgecomb quarries. As early as 1832 many rooms, walls and arches of Fort Knox in Prospect were built of Maine granite. The product was often shipped out of state …

Lubambe Mine in Copperbelt, was the largest underground mine in Zambia, producing approximately 1.47 million metric tons per annum (mmtpa) of Run-of-Mine (ROM) and primarily produced copper (38.98 thousand tonnes) in 2021. The Lubambe Mine is owned by EMR Capital Group;ZCCM Investment Holdings Plc, and is due to operate until 2041. The second largest …
PIEDRA, Canteras y Producción, owns 22 mining concessions in the districts of Burguillos del Cerro, Valencia del Ventoso y Fregenal de la Sierra. The 80% of the reserves of these concessions correspond to a dark granites. PCP, currently is working in two of its quarries, where Negro Batalla and Negro Ochavo Especial granites are extracted.

Sentinel Copper Mine in North-Western, was the largest surface mine in Zambia, producing approximately 59.5 million metric tons per annum (mmtpa) of Run-of-Mine (ROM) and primarily produced copper (248.7 thousand tonnes) in 2021. The Sentinel Copper Mine is owned by First Quantum Minerals Ltd, and is due to operate until 2035. The second largest surface mine with …

1 Ownership of Artisanal and Small-Scale Mining Rights in Zambia 1.0 Introduction Mining is the major driver of economic activities in Zambia, accounting for about 12% of the Gross Domestic Product (GDP) and more than 70% of the country's export earnings1. Further, the sector employs about 59,371 people, making it fifth on the country's top sector employment index.
